Matthew Dellavedova is a Partner at Bessemer Venture Partners based in San Francisco, California, where he leads early-stage investments in enterprise software and artificial intelligence. Before joining the firm in January 2023, he was an investor at Index Ventures from 2018 to 2022 and previously worked as a startup software engineer. He has led over 15 investments to date, building a portfolio that includes technology startups like Vercel, Hex, and Jasper, which was acquired by Hugging Face. Recently, he directed Bessemer's $50 million Series B investment in Cal.com in March 2025 and spoke on AI investment trends at TechCrunch Disrupt. Holding an MBA from the Stanford Graduate School of Business and a computer science degree from the University of Melbourne, Dellavedova focuses on funding technical founders across developer tools, cybersecurity, and fintech.
